软件项目管理解决什么问题
-
软件项目管理主要解决以下几个问题:
1. 资源调配问题:软件项目通常涉及到大量的资源,包括人力、时间和资金等。项目管理需要合理分配和安排这些资源,以确保项目能按时按质地完成。
2. 进度控制问题:软件开发过程中,有很多不确定因素会影响项目进度,如需求变更、技术难题等。项目管理需要进行进度控制,及时发现和解决问题,以保证项目能按计划进行,并尽早发现潜在的延期风险。
3. 风险管理问题:软件开发过程中存在一定的风险,如技术风险、需求变更风险等。项目管理需要进行风险管理,识别和评估风险,并制定相应的应对措施,以减少风险对项目的影响。
4. 沟通协调问题:软件项目通常涉及多个团队成员的合作,需要进行良好的沟通和协调。项目管理需要建立有效的沟通机制,促进团队成员之间的合作和信息共享,以提高项目效率和质量。
5. 质量控制问题:软件项目的成功与否往往取决于软件的质量。项目管理需要制定相应的质量控制措施,包括测试、评审等,以确保交付的软件满足用户的需求和质量标准。
综上所述,软件项目管理通过合理调配资源、控制进度、管理风险、加强沟通协调和实施质量控制等手段,解决了软件项目开发过程中的众多问题,提高了项目的成功率和效益。
2年前 -
软件项目管理是一种以组织,计划和管理软件开发项目的过程。它的目标是确保项目能够按时,按预算和按要求完成。软件项目管理解决的问题包括:
1. 项目范围管理:软件项目通常会有一个明确的范围,包括功能和特性。项目管理可以确保项目范围得到明确定义,并且能够适应变化。它可以帮助团队和利益相关者明确项目目标和关键要素,并确保项目在范围内被执行。
2. 时间管理:软件项目通常具有明确的时间限制。项目管理可以帮助制定一个详细的项目计划,包括确定任务的时间表和里程碑。通过有效的时间管理,项目管理可以确保项目按时交付。
3. 成本管理:软件项目开发通常需要投入大量资源,包括人员,设备和软件工具。项目管理可以帮助估计和控制项目的成本,并确保项目在预算内完成。它可以帮助制定预算和资源分配计划,并监控项目的成本与实际开销之间的差距。
4. 风险管理:软件项目面临各种风险,包括技术风险,市场风险和组织风险。项目管理可以帮助识别和评估项目的风险,并制定应对措施。它可以帮助团队建立风险管理计划,并监控项目进展以及任何新的风险因素。
5. 沟通和合作:软件开发项目通常涉及多个团队成员,以及与利益相关者的合作。项目管理可以提供有效的沟通和合作框架,以确保信息的流动和团队之间的良好协调。它可以帮助制定沟通计划,并确保关键信息在团队内外共享。
总之,软件项目管理通过确保项目有明确的目标,优化资源分配,控制时间和成本,评估和应对风险以及促进沟通和合作,解决了软件项目开发过程中的许多问题。它可以提高项目的可交付性和质量,并确保项目能够在预期的时间和成本范围内成功交付。
2年前 -
软件项目管理解决的问题是在软件项目的整个生命周期中,有效地管理和控制项目的进度、质量、资源和成本,以确保项目能够按时交付,并满足客户的需求和预期。
具体来说,软件项目管理解决以下几个主要问题:
1. 时间管理:软件项目通常有明确的交付时间要求,因此需要合理安排项目的时间进度,确定合理的里程碑和阶段性交付目标。软件项目管理通过制定详细的项目计划、任务分解和里程碑规划,帮助项目团队合理安排工作,提高项目的时间管理能力。
2. 质量管理:软件项目的质量是客户最为关注的要素之一。软件项目管理通过制定和执行质量管理计划,包括需求分析、设计评审、编码规范、单元测试、系统测试等活动,确保软件产品能够符合客户的需求和规定的质量标准。
3. 资源管理:软件开发过程需要合理分配和管理项目所需的资源,包括人力资源、硬件设备、软件工具等。软件项目管理通过集中管理和调配项目资源,使得资源能够最大限度地发挥作用,提高项目的效率和效果。
4. 成本管理:软件项目通常有明确的预算要求,需要合理控制项目的成本。软件项目管理通过制定和执行成本管理计划,包括成本估算、成本控制、成本考核等活动,帮助项目团队控制和管理项目的成本,尽量避免成本超支。
5. 风险管理:软件项目开发过程中会面临各种风险,包括技术风险、需求变更风险、人员流失风险等。软件项目管理通过制定风险管理计划、风险评估和监控等活动,帮助项目团队识别和评估项目风险,并制定相应的应对策略,减少项目风险对项目进度和质量的影响。
综上所述,软件项目管理通过有效的管理工具和方法,解决项目开发过程中的时间、质量、资源、成本和风险等问题,提高项目的管理效率和项目团队的协作能力,从而实现项目的成功交付。
2年前